Tighten the mounting nuts using your hand. First locate the mounting and loosen the hex nut that hold the clamp to the bottom of the counter top put the thread locker on the shaft where the nut and clamp will stop when tight to the counter top then with the faucet base in place tighten the nut to hold the faucet. If you can�t get a basin wrench on it, and don�t want to remove your sink from the counter, then i�d recommend taking this fixture back and finding one that would be easier to install in your situation. The photo you posted looks like it is a type of faucet that has a single post and nut mounting, i have fixed this problem with a basin wrench and thread locker.
